Deploying Cloud Enterprise Resource Planning

Successfully transitioning to a cloud Systems demands careful planning and adherence to best methods. Begin with a thorough analysis of your current processes to identify pain points and define clear objectives. Verify data transfer is handled with utmost precision, employing robust testing procedures to maintain data reliability. Involve key stakeholders across all departments to gain buy-in and address potential objections. Moreover, explore the vendor’s security measures and adherence frameworks to protect sensitive records. A phased rollout approach, starting with a pilot program, often proves more effective than a "big bang" strategy. Finally, ongoing education for your team is vital to maximize the system's potential and ensure a positive return on resources.

Selecting the Right ERP System: Cloud vs. On-Premise

The decision between a cloud-based Enterprise Resource Planning system and an on-premise solution is a significant one for any growing business. On-premise ERPs offer total control over your data and infrastructure, but require a considerable upfront investment in hardware, software licenses, and a dedicated IT team to manage and support the system. Conversely, a hosted ERP typically involves a subscription model, reducing initial costs and shifting the responsibility of systems management to the vendor. In addition, cloud solutions offer improved scalability and accessibility, enabling staff to work from anywhere. Ultimately, the best choice is dictated by your business’s specific needs, budget, and long-term goals.
